Output 59ae24624825fcee37709a4089332cce9834fe1ebfbae70aa44f32273ecff9d2:1

value
21797581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7049bcb24143412cfe1d402d5c98e842fd30e0e2 OP_EQUALVERIFY OP_CHECKSIG
address
1BEj1q31NtNmNq4T9TGLktQgaxbwRRWABv
transaction
59ae24624825fcee37709a4089332cce9834fe1ebfbae70aa44f32273ecff9d2
spent
true